Output def074b9c00f8df4a5711324b0b60f1cecbc7aa94f5acb27397f51b15f01292e:0

value
6680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d45c3c2794bf78e492313865c29c0095601650 OP_EQUAL
address
3593KhAXJPFtw1dVDo7XGJ3ML8sRvz9W2E
transaction
def074b9c00f8df4a5711324b0b60f1cecbc7aa94f5acb27397f51b15f01292e
spent
true